Linear actuator DL24-05B5-05CU


For Sale: One Warner Electric Linear Actuator. (it is new, never used old stock) The scratches on it are from the staples in the box.
This is basically a electric hydraulic cylinder. A electric motor turns gears that turn a screw that has a nut on it that moves the shaft in and out. There is no hydraulic oil in it.
24 Volts DC. (change polarity to change direction)
5 inch Stroke (I don't think it had built in end limits)
Overall length 18 1/2 inches, 17 inches between mounting holes.
I believe that this unit was made for Hospital beds (power adjust) However you can use it to move whatever you want (5 inches) as long as you connect it properly and it is less than 500 LBs.
